Как устроены системы обработки происшествий в текущем времени
Механизмы обработки инцидентов в реальном времени составляют собой комплекс софтверных частей, которые принимают, исследуют и обрабатывают потоки данных с наименьшей задержкой. Такие системы функционируют постоянно, гарантируя быструю отклик на приходящую информацию.
Фундамент структуры составляют три основных компонента: источники происшествий, обработчики и хранилища данных. Источники формируют постоянный массив данных через выделенные каналы. Обработчики реализуют селекцию, преобразование и агрегацию данных согласно указанным нормам.
Актуальные решения задействуют распределенную построение для достижения большой производительности. Приходящие события делятся между множеством компонентов обработки, что дает 1иксбет масштабироваться горизонтально и обслуживать миллионы инцидентов в секунду.
Ключевым показателем выступает время реакции — промежуток между принятием происшествия и выдачей ответа. Эффективные системы обрабатывают информацию за миллисекунды, что критично для денежных переводов и комплексов охраны.
Источники инцидентов: измерители, приложения, логи, переводы и пользовательские манипуляции
Происшествия попадают в комплекс из разных источников, каждый из которых производит уникальный тип данных. Сенсоры производственного оборудования отправляют значения температуры, давления, вибрации и других физических показателей с частотой до сотен замеров в секунду.
Веб-приложения и мобильные службы генерируют происшествия при контакте пользователя с интерфейсом. Нажатия, обзоры страниц, добавление товаров создают непрерывный поток деятельности. Серверные сервисы регистрируют обращения к API и изменения статуса соединений.
Системные логи фиксируют технические события: неполадки, оповещения, информационные оповещения о деятельности инфраструктуры. Выделенные службы накапливают записи с серверов и контейнеров, отправляя их в 1xbet казино для единой обработки.
Денежные операции производят критически важные инциденты при переводах и оплатах. Банковские системы производят сведения о каждой операции с картой и изменении баланса. Биржевые системы записывают ордера на покупку и реализацию ценностей.
Построение непрерывной обслуживания
Поточная преобразование строится на принципе непрерывного передвижения данных через последовательность обработчиков без промежуточного записи. Инциденты идут через череду преобразований, где каждый компонент выполняет определённую роль: селекцию, расширение, агрегацию или распределение.
Базовая архитектура включает слой приёма данных, который принимает происшествия из внешних источников и конвертирует их в стандартизированный формат. Последующий ярус осуществляет бизнес-логику: считает показатели, выявляет аномалии, задействует правила обработки. Итоги отправляются в ярус отдачи для фиксации или пересылки.
Актуальные системы предоставляют два варианта к обработке. Первый обслуживает каждое инцидент персонально сразу после принятия. Второй формирует происшествия в небольшие порции и преобразует их с промежутком в несколько секунд. Решение определяется от условий к задержке и количеству данных.
Модули структуры сотрудничают через унифицированные соединения, что дает изменять определенные компоненты без модификации полной системы. 1хбет казино обеспечивает пластичность при корректировке запросов.
Очереди и шины данных: как инциденты транспортируются между сервисами
Транспортировка инцидентов между модулями системы выполняется через особые инструменты передачи сообщениями. Очереди данных гарантируют стабильную доставку данных от отправителей к потребителям с обеспечением безопасности при неполадках.
Шины данных составляют собой распределённые платформы для публикования и регистрации на последовательности событий. Отправители передают данные в именованные очереди, а потребители регистрируются на интересующие темы. Такая схема позволяет отдельному инциденту охватывать множества адресатов параллельно.
Главные свойства механизмов передачи происшествий содержат:
- Пропускную способность — число сообщений в отрезок времени
- Латентность передачи — время между передачей и получением
- Гарантии передачи — уровень устойчивости передачи
- Очередность — сохранение цепочки инцидентов
Средства буферизации накапливают события при кратковременной неготовности получателей. 1xbet казино хранит сообщения на диске до момента завершенной обработки. Копирование между узлами исключает потерю данных при аварии серверов.
Варианты обслуживания
Комплексы реального времени задействуют разнообразные подходы обработки инцидентов в обусловленности от бизнес-требований и природы данных. Каждая вариант задает метод объединения, изучения и модификации поступающих массивов.
Обработка индивидуальных происшествий изучает каждое сообщение автономно от иных. Механизм использует правила отбора и расширения к каждой строке сразу после приема. Такой подход снижает задержки и соответствует для важных ситуаций с условием немедленной отклика.
Временная преобразование группирует инциденты по хронологическим периодам или количеству записей. Система аккумулирует сведения в протяжение конкретного периода, потом осуществляет агрегацию и подсчет метрик. Интервалы могут быть постоянными, динамичными или сеансовыми в зависимости от правил программы.
Обслуживание с сохранением состояния поддерживает окружение между инцидентами. Система запоминает временные результаты, регистраторы, сохраненные величины для следующих подсчетов. 1иксбет эксплуатирует децентрализованное хранилище для обеспечения непротиворечивости. Вариант без статуса обрабатывает инциденты независимо, что упрощает увеличение.
Хранение данных: активные (real-time) и долгосрочные (архивные) слои
Архитектура размещения данных в системах реального времени разделяется на несколько уровней в связи от периодичности запроса и условий к темпу чтения. Такое сегментация улучшает расходы и гарантирует равновесие между скоростью и расходами.
Горячий уровень хранит свежие сведения, к которым нужен моментальный обращение. Данные размещается в оперативной ОЗУ или на быстрых SSD-дисках для сокращения времени ответа. Базы этого яруса обрабатывают тысячи вызовов в секунду. Период размещения равен от нескольких часов до нескольких дней.
Промежуточный ярус содержит данные промежуточного возраста для анализа и формирования отчетов. Происшествия транспортируются сюда автоматом после исхода срока свежести. 1хбет казино обеспечивает соотношение между быстротой обращения и количеством хранения.
Холодный архивный слой применяется для длительного хранения архивных данных. Сведения помещается на экономичных носителях с низкоскоростным чтением. Хранилища эксплуатируются для соответствия условиям регуляторов, ревизии и исследования закономерностей. Промежуток размещения может доходить нескольких лет.
Масштабирование и живучесть
Умение платформы преобразовывать расширяющиеся объёмы данных и сохранять функциональность при отказах определяет её стабильность в промышленной окружении. Архитектура должна включать механизмы горизонтального расширения и дублирования важных элементов.
Горизонтальное масштабирование включает дополнительные узлы обработки при увеличении трафика. Инциденты самостоятельно разделяются между доступными машинами в соответствии алгоритмам распределения. Платформа гибко адаптируется к модификации массива данных без прерывания.
Инструменты гарантирования устойчивости 1xbet казино содержат:
- Дублирование данных между компонентами для исключения утрат
- Автоматизированное смену на дублирующие части при неполадке
- Промежуточные снимки для сохранения статуса преобразования
- Возобновление с возобновлением с последнего записанного статуса
Разделение трафика реализуется на фундаменте идентификаторов сегментации, которые определяют распределение событий к модулям. 1иксбет гарантирует последовательную обработку взаимосвязанных происшествий на единственном узле. Наблюдение состояния серверов дает находить деградацию эффективности и перенаправлять операции.
Отслеживание и оповещение: как следят состояние потоков и реагируют на отклонения
Непрестанное контроль за состоянием комплекса обработки происшествий дает находить трудности до их существенного эффекта на рабочие процессы. Системы контроля собирают метрики эффективности и генерируют оповещения при расхождениях от обычных величин.
Ключевые метрики включают темп прихода событий, отсрочку обработки, объем очередей и процент неполадок. Механизмы отслеживают нагрузку CPU, эксплуатацию ОЗУ и дискового пространства на компонентах системы. Диаграммы визуализируют динамику показателей в реальном времени.
Граничные значения задают рамки обычного действия для каждой показателя. При превышении порогов механизм автоматически формирует предупреждения для операторов. 1хбет казино дает задавать нормы алертинга с принятием серьезности многообразных классов событий.
Выявление аномалий применяет аналитические приемы для определения аномальных закономерностей в последовательностях данных. Алгоритмы выявляют острые броски нагрузки, нестандартные череды происшествий, сомнительную активность. Автоматические ответы охватывают масштабирование ресурсов, перенаправление на запасные пути или уменьшение поступающего нагрузки.
Примеры применения платформ обработки инцидентов
Финансовые компании эксплуатируют механизмы обработки событий для выявления поддельных операций. Алгоритмы анализируют каждую операцию по карте в время проведения, соотнося с прошлыми шаблонами активности пользователя. При обнаружении странной деятельности комплекс блокирует перевод за миллисекунды.
Онлайн-магазины применяют потоковую обработку для адаптации предложений продуктов. Инциденты обзора страниц, добавления в тележку и покупок обрабатываются в реальном времени. Механизм создает свежие советы на базе мгновенного поведения клиента.
Производственные предприятия развертывают мониторинг аппаратуры для предиктивного сервиса. Датчики на заводских участках передают данные колебаний, температуры и расхода энергии. 1иксбет анализирует сведения и предвидит вероятные неисправности, что дает проектировать обслуживание без внеплановых прерываний.
Перевозочные компании следят перемещение партий и оптимизируют пути перевозки. GPS-трекеры генерируют местоположение транспортных автомобилей каждые несколько секунд. Платформа учитывает пробки и срочность доставок для адаптивной корректировки маршрутов и уведомления клиентов о времени приезда.